Originating from Brazil, this necklace is composed of grade A green aventurine baroque beads. This variety of quartz is appreciated for its hues that can vary from light green to a deeper green.
Depending on the stones, aventurine may show white areas, slight inclusions, and subtle shimmering reflections. These variations are linked to the stone's natural composition and formation.
The baroque shape of the beads preserves the organic aspect of the mineral. Each element has its own contours, dimensions, color, and patterns.
